About Analog Devices

Analog Devices, Inc. (NASDAQ: ADI) is a global semiconductor leader that bridges the physical and digital worlds to enable breakthroughs at the Intelligent Edge. ADI combines analog, digital, AI, and software technologies into solutions that combat climate change, reliably connect humans and the world, and help drive advancements in automation and robotics, mobility, healthcare, energy and data centers. With revenue of more than $11 billion in FY25, ADI ensures today's innovators stay Ahead of What's Possible. Learn more at www.analog.com and on LinkedIn and X.

          

Role Purpose

Serve as the ModelN system owner for Channel Operations. Lead the Model N 2.0 Automation program, driving automation and standardization of channel data management processes across claims, POS, inventory, and pricing.

As the business lead, partner hand-in-hand with IT and business stakeholders to define requirements, prioritize enhancements by business impact, and deliver scalable, well-tested solutions that improve efficiency, accuracy, and operational performance.

Core Responsibilities

  • Own Model N 2.0 initiatives across channel design registrations, claims, POS, and inventory — speeding turnaround to distributors, reducing internal workload, and fully utilizing Model N functionality, including:

    • Automating Negative Claims submissions, POS & Inventory processing, price bucket sync, and inventory reconciliation

    • Ship & Debit (S&D) automation, including workflows and agent-based communication to resolve S&D rejections

    • Standardizing and optimizing claim processing, including reject-code cleanup for 1:1 mapping and claim processing in local currency

    • Automating Quoted Inventory Repricing (QIR) and Field Transfer (FTR) between distributors

  • Translate business needs into clear business requirements, functional specifications, and data mapping (tables, fields, joins) that IT can build against, and author and execute test plans to validate delivery

  • Work within an agile delivery model — partnering with IT and cross-functional teams to intake, prioritize, and deliver enhancements iteratively, with disciplined backlog management and regular release cycles

  • Support broader channel data management improvement efforts including partner self-service capabilities, system and integration enhancements, and process redesigns

  • Coordinate across connected enterprise systems (ERP, e-commerce, EDI, and reporting) so channel data flows accurately end to end

  • Establish, own, and report out on a closed-loop process to prioritize, execute, and measure the effectiveness of Model N automation initiatives

What you need to know about the Boston Tech Scene

Boston is a powerhouse for technology innovation thanks to world-class research universities like MIT and Harvard and a robust pipeline of venture capital investment. Host to the first telephone call and one of the first general-purpose computers ever put into use, Boston is now a hub for biotechnology, robotics and artificial intelligence — though it’s also home to several B2B software giants. So it’s no surprise that the city consistently ranks among the greatest startup ecosystems in the world.

Key Facts About Boston Tech

  • Number of Tech Workers: 269,000; 9.4% of overall workforce (2024 CompTIA survey)
  • Major Tech Employers: Thermo Fisher Scientific, Toast, Klaviyo, HubSpot, DraftKings
  • Key Industries: Artificial intelligence, biotechnology, robotics, software, aerospace
  • Funding Landscape: $15.7 billion in venture capital funding in 2024 (Pitchbook)
  • Notable Investors: Summit Partners, Volition Capital, Bain Capital Ventures, MassVentures, Highland Capital Partners
  • Research Centers and Universities: MIT, Harvard University, Boston College, Tufts University, Boston University, Northeastern University, Smithsonian Astrophysical Observatory, National Bureau of Economic Research, Broad Institute, Lowell Center for Space Science & Technology, National Emerging Infectious Diseases Laboratories
